sentence [ˈsɛntəns] n 1. (Linguistics) a sequence of words capable of standing alone to make an assertion, ask a question, or give a command, usually consisting of a subject and a predicate containing a finite verb 2. (Law) the judgment formally pronounced upon a person convicted in criminal proceedings, esp the decision as to what punishment is to be imposed 3. an opinion, judgment, or decision 4. (Music, other) Music another word for period [11] 5. (Christianity / Ecclesiastical Terms) any short passage of scripture employed in liturgical use the funeral sentences 6. (Philosophy / Logic) Logic a well-formed expression, without variables 7. Archaic a proverb, maxim, or aphorism vb (Law) (tr) to pronounce sentence on (a convicted person) in a court of law the judge sentenced the murderer to life imprisonment [via Old French from Latin sententia a way of thinking, from sentīre to feel] sentential [sɛnˈtɛnʃəl] adj sententially adv Sentence of judges—Bk. of St. Albans, 1486.
